NMDAR subunit 1 Ab [Presence] in Serum by Immunofluorescence

NMDAR1 Ab Ser Ql IF

Definition

  • Antineuronal antibodies against NMDAR1 are detected and characterized based on immunofluorescence staining pattern on multiple neuronal, non-neuronal tissues, and transformed substrate cells.
